Output 627c793802e9431ada88840684aa8f24370ff318bc67a73baba8785744a96e24:4

value
37030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7e59f61e94034dc2be8e6c6ec4ac4c28163535 OP_EQUAL
address
3MtAczGoBUc79KA4gyHi11ATMshyavg4Ku
transaction
627c793802e9431ada88840684aa8f24370ff318bc67a73baba8785744a96e24
spent
true